What Are the Benefits of Certified Grid Tie Inverters?

certified grid tie inverters ensures high efficiency and grid friendliness through stringent certification. For instance, UL 1741-SA certified products, their best conversion efficiency stands at 98.7% (e.g., Huawei SUN2000-10KTL), 3.7% higher power output than non-certified ones (average 95%), so that the 10kW system has a yearly average of 550kWh of electricity (calculated with 1500 hours of sunlight). The other benefit is worth $82 (electricity saved at $0.15/kWh). German norm VDE-AR-N 4105 requires a rate of total harmonic distortion (THD) lower than 3%, and accredited inverters (e.g., SMA Sunny Tripower) are able to reduce grid pollution by 90% and avoid fines due to poor power quality (up to 5000 euros/case in the EU).

Policy compliance has an immediate linkage to policy dividends. U.S. Federal tax credit (ITC 30%) is available only for certified grid tie inverters, allowing the users to save $3,000 ($10,000 system price) while purchasing a 10kW system. In California NEM 3.0 program, certified models allow time-of-use tariff (TOU) optimization, peak hour rebate rate of $0.48 /kWh (valley hour $0.12), with smart scheduling strategy, 35% increase in yearly revenue. India’s MNRE statistics reveal that users of BIS-certified inverters are eligible for a 40% subsidy (up to $5,000) which brings down the net cost of a 5kW system from $7,000 to $4,200, and enhances IRR from 12% to 22%.

Security threats are hugely minimized. UL 1741 certification requires less than 2 seconds of anti-island protection response time, and in the 2020 California wildfires, only 0.5% of certified inverters failed (up to 8% for non-certified units), avoiding fire liability claims of more than $10,000 per year. EU CE marking requires compulsory leakage current < 300mA (standard EN 62109-2) certified units (e.g., Fronius Symo) grounding fault protection trigger time < 0.1 seconds and electric shock risk is reduced by 95%.

Grid support functionalities create extra value. IEEE 1547-2018 compliant grid tie inverters such as SolarEdge HD-Wave ensure dynamic voltage regulation (±10% range) to deliver round-the-clock power to 87% of customers in a Texas grid failure in 2021. The non-certified variants have a power failure rate of up to 45%. SMA 60Hz model German company by the certification of Saudi SASO, the tolerance of 80-280V voltage range, to have room for voltage fluctuations of Middle East power grid, failure percentage from 12% to 1.8%.

Higher asset value and market competitiveness. Bloomberg New Energy Finance (BNEF) statistics show adoption of certified grid tie inverters photovoltaic power plant sales agreement (PPA) premium of $0.005 /kWh (gridsupport protection), 10MW project annual boost of $43,000. The average premium rate for residences with certified systems was 4.2% (CoreLogic data) compared to 1.5% for non-certified systems. Tesla Solar Roof homeowners get 15% lower insurance premiums for UL-certified inverters.

Technological innovations accelerate the massification of certified models. In 2023, Huawei launched the world’s first silicon Carbide (SiC) certified grid tie inverters with a 1.2kW/kg power density (traditional model 0.8kW/kg), reducing volume by 30% and decreasing installation cost by 25%. Enphase IQ8 series are CA Rule 21 certified and can handle up to 288 parallel network units (up to the traditional 64 units), suitable for megawatt sites and reducing balanced system (BOS) expenses by 15%.

Environmental benefits are favored by policies. The EU Green Deal makes new PV installations until 2030 use certified grid tie inverters (efficiency ≥97%) to compel a carbon saving of 1.2 tonnes /MWh (0.3 tonnes lower than non-certified systems). The California CPUC estimates that for every 10% penetration of statewide certified inverters, the grid renewable energy capacity is boosted by 3.5GW, corresponding to a CO₂ saving of 6 million tons/year.

International precedents demonstrate lasting worth. AS/NZS 4777 certified Goodwe DNS models such as in Australia maintained a level of 98% uptime for the 2022 floods when the un-certified versions managed a rate of over 20% failures. China Certification (CGC) records show TOPCon products with certified inverters (such as solar power SG125HX) where the system PR value (performance ratio) reached 86.5% (only 78% when it is un-certified combined). These had earned over $18,000 after 25 cycles. Tesla Powerwall VPP (Virtual Power Plant) program, which was done together with certified grid tie inverters, reduced from $1,200 to $2,000 per household annually with an IRR of more than 25%.
